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Charing Cross (Glasgow) to Dorchester West start from as little as £64.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Charing Cross (Glasgow) to Dorchester West start from £165.20 one way, or £236.00 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Charing Cross (Glasgow) to Dorchester West are available for £170.80 one way, or £341.60 return

Station Facilities

The station is equipped with a ticket office that operates from early morning until late evening, ensuring you can purchase your tickets conveniently. For those who prefer the self-service route, ticket machines are available, supporting online ticket collection.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access across the station, including both platforms. While there are no accessible toilets, accessible ticket machines and induction loops are in place to aid those with hearing impairments.

Help and Support

Customer support is readily available, with staff ready to assist from the ticket office or via the designated help points scattered across the station. Whether you have questions about your journey or need additional support, they're there to lend a hand. For digital inquiries, you can reach out through customer.relations@scotrail.co.uk. Lost property services are also available, providing a safe return for misplaced items.

Refreshments and Amenities

For those waiting for their next train, you can grab a cup of coffee at the café or pick up a newspaper from WHSmith. While the station lacks a currency exchange and 1st class lounge, the essentials are well covered with the presence of an ATM. Public Wi-Fi is not available, but pay phones are located within, catering to any necessary communications.

Facilities and Amenities

While Dorchester West station might be modest in size, it has a wealth of essential features. However, travelers should note that there is no ticket office or machines on site, so it's wise to purchase your tickets in advance online. An induction loop is present to aid those who are hearing impaired. For those needing assistance, helpful staff can be reached via a dedicated help point. Although there are no dedicated facilities for waiting or shopping, there's a seating area where you can rest while waiting for your train. CCTV is operational, ensuring your safety during your visit.

Access and Assistance

Accessibility at Dorchester West station is quite accommodating although there are limitations. The platforms provide step-free access through public footpaths, though transitioning between platforms via the footbridge involves stairs. However, a ramp is available for train access, allowing ease for those with mobility needs. It's worth mentioning that no accessible taxis or designated set-down/pick-up points are present, so planning your journey with these considerations in mind is important.
